Starting with a classic and simple design, the skateboard outline tattoo is a popular choice among skaters. It's a timeless piece that pays homage to the beloved deck. Here's how you can bring this tattoo to life:

  • Choose a bold and clean outline of a skateboard, capturing the iconic shape and curves.
  • Consider adding subtle details like the brand logo or a personalized message on the underside.
  • Position it on your forearm, upper arm, or even your chest for a bold statement.

This tattoo serves as a subtle yet powerful reminder of your love for skateboarding. It's a great conversation starter and a way to connect with fellow skaters.

If you want to capture the adrenaline and excitement of skateboarding, a tattoo depicting a skater in action is the way to go. Imagine a tattoo that freezes a moment of pure joy and freedom.

  • Opt for a realistic or stylized depiction of a skater mid-trick, capturing the movement and energy.
  • Incorporate elements like a ramp, a half-pipe, or even a cityscape to add depth and context.
  • Experiment with colors to bring the tattoo to life, or go for a black-and-white sketch for a more classic look.

This tattoo not only celebrates your love for skateboarding but also serves as a reminder to embrace the spirit of adventure and live life to the fullest.

Skate culture is rich with symbols and iconic imagery. A tattoo that incorporates these symbols can be a unique and personal way to express your connection to the skateboarding community.

  • Explore options like the iconic "skull and crossbones" symbol, often associated with the DIY and punk influences in skate culture.
  • Consider adding other skate-related symbols, such as the "peace, love, and skate" hand gesture or the "V" for victory sign.
  • Experiment with different styles, from traditional tattoo art to more modern and abstract interpretations.

By incorporating these symbols, you create a tattoo that tells a story and represents your journey within the skate community.

Get creative and design a tattoo inspired by your own customized skateboard deck. This tattoo allows you to showcase your unique style and the story behind your board.

  • Choose a section of your deck design, such as the artwork on the bottom or the grip tape pattern.
  • Incorporate personal touches like your name, initials, or a meaningful quote.
  • Add a touch of color or keep it simple with a black-and-white design.

This tattoo is a celebration of your creativity and the bond you share with your custom deck.

Tattoos are a great way to tell a story, and what better story to tell than your journey as a skateboarder? Create a tattoo that represents your personal growth and milestones in skateboarding.

  • Design a timeline-like tattoo with different elements representing significant moments in your skating career.
  • Incorporate symbols, dates, or even quotes that hold special meaning to you.
  • Consider a minimalist approach with simple line work or go for a more detailed and colorful design.

This tattoo becomes a visual representation of your dedication, perseverance, and the joys of skateboarding.

Pay homage to your favorite skateboarding icon or legend with a tattoo inspired by their iconic style or signature trick.

  • Research and choose a skater whose style or impact on the sport resonates with you.
  • Design a tattoo that captures their signature move, such as a kickflip or an ollie.
  • Add personal touches by incorporating their name, nickname, or a quote they're known for.

This tattoo not only honors the skater but also serves as a reminder of the inspiration and motivation they bring to your skating journey.

⚠️ Note: When choosing a tattoo design, it's crucial to consider its placement and size. Ensure the tattoo artist understands your vision and can bring it to life accurately. Remember, tattoos are a permanent commitment, so take your time and choose a design that resonates deeply with you.
